As the crypto community eagerly awaits the SEC’s decision on Bitcoin ETF applications, SEC Chair Gary Gensler has issued a list of considerations for potential investors in the crypto market. 

Gensler, known for its skeptical stance on cryptocurrencies, aims to remind investors of the risks associated with the industry. The advisory serves as a timely reminder of the potential approval of Bitcoin ETF applications, which could provide a regulated entry point for retail and institutional investors.

SEC Chair Gensler Raises Alarm Ahead Of Bitcoin ETF Approval

In a recent communication on X (formerly Twitter), Gensler highlighted several key points for individuals contemplating investments in crypto assets. 

The SEC’s chair message emphasized the need for caution, as some entities offering crypto investment services allegedly may not be compliant with relevant laws, including federal securities regulations, from the regulator’s point of view. 

Gensler further emphasized that investors in crypto asset securities may lack access to “crucial information” and other essential protections typically associated with traditional investments. 

However, this viewpoint seems somewhat unclear, as the crypto ecosystem is abundant with information, operating on an open-source and decentralized technology that allows investors to gather information before making any investment decisions.

Furthermore, Gensler’s advisory highlighted the “exceptionally risky” and volatile nature of investments in crypto assets. The SEC chair pointed out instances where major platforms and specific crypto assets have faced insolvency or significant losses in value. 

While this is not different from traditional finance (TradFi), it is worth noting that platforms and firms facing insolvency often face regulatory pressure to compensate creditors for their lost investments in the crypto market. This differs from the traditional finance sector, where such compensation is not always guaranteed.

However, the SEC chair emphasized that investments in crypto assets remain subject to substantial risk, cautioning potential investors to consider the inherent volatility and potential price fluctuations associated with these assets.

Caution Against Crypto Scams

Another significant aspect of Gensler’s message was his emphasis on the ongoing presence of fraudulent activities within the crypto space. 

Gensler warned that fraudsters are capitalizing on the increasing popularity of crypto assets to allegedly deceive retail investors through scams, including bogus coin offerings, Ponzi and pyramid schemes, and even outright theft.  However, it is important to note that scams and criminal activities exist in the crypto space and traditional finance. 

Ultimately, Gensler urged investors to remain vigilant and exercise due diligence when considering investments in the crypto market.

Gensler’s advisory arrives at a crucial juncture as the SEC is expected to decide on Bitcoin ETF applications. The advisory could be seen as an attempt to remind investors of the potential risks associated with cryptocurrencies before introducing regulated investment vehicles like Bitcoin ETFs.
